TRUTH

What good is truth
if words tumble you.

Moses' tablets hurled
from Babel's tower.

Dervishes
twirling meanings.

Ravings
boxing in Pandora.

Cassandra
prophesying endings.

Not even for love's sake
can I whisper in your ear
those lies you wish to hear.

(From: Out Of Love And Other Poems, by Kitty Madeson (1993) Stone Soup Poets, Boston.)
